Bullet Train Travel from Kyoto to Tokyo: A Swift and Convenient Journey

The sleek and efficient bullet trains of Japan offer a rapid and comfortable mode of transportation between major cities. One of the most popular routes is the journey from Kyoto, a city renowned for its rich cultural heritage, to Tokyo, the bustling capital.

Travel Time: Approximately 2 Hours and 20 Minutes

A high-speed bullet train typically takes approximately 2 hours and 20 minutes to cover the distance between Kyoto and Tokyo. This travel time may vary slightly depending on the specific service chosen and any scheduled station stops.

Service Options and Variations

There are several bullet train services operating on the Kyoto-Tokyo line, providing passengers with flexibility in their travel plans. The fastest option, the Nozomi (のぞみ) service, completes the journey in 2 hours and 9 minutes without intermediate stops. Other services, such as the Hikari (ひかり) and Sakura (さくら) trains, may take slightly longer as they include stops at stations along the route.

Influencing Factors

The following factors can also affect the travel time of a bullet train from Kyoto to Tokyo:

  • Time of Day: During peak commuting hours, trains may be more crowded and subject to minor delays.
  • Station Halts: Some bullet train services make scheduled stops at major stations, such as Shin-Osaka and Nagoya, which can add to the overall travel time.
  • Operational Conditions: Unforeseen circumstances, such as weather events or technical issues, may occasionally result in delays.
